Cancer Drug May Boost Risk of Gastrointestinal Perforation (HealthDay)
HealthDay – MONDAY, May 25 (HealthDay News) — The use of the drug bevacizumab
(Avastin) in combination with chemotherapy greatly increases the risk of
gastrointestinal perforations in cancer patients, new research has
found.
